Our lab currently uses a PT-104 Data Logger to monitor the temperature of our environment. It is excellent.
We've been asked to begin monitoring the humidity of our environment.

Is the PT-104 Data Logger capable of using resistance measurements to evaluate the humidity of an environment, and if so, what hardware do I require for this kind of measurement? Is there a humidity probe available from Pico Technology for the PT-104?

If it cannot be done, are there other Pico Technology products that have these capabilities?

The answer to your first question is no, unfortunately, you can't use a PT104 resistance measurement to evaluate humidity.

We do have a humidity sensor, but it was intended for use with our, now discontinued, DrDaq Data Logger (which was intended for educational/hobby use, so the humidity sensor only has a +/-10% accuracy). If you want to perform temperature accuracy compensation due to relative humidity levels, in order to increase the validity of a high accuracy temperature measurement made by the PT-104 then, if you perform an internet search, you are likely to find a more suitably accurate humidity probe.
